Output 89aeebf961b73d75620cad6a9cdaf6d2cd539cd59a40a99967138e116d14ab52:14

value
6509
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8676376fea16a5916a7f0a932ccef8ddf79766b12967a6bdc273ae45db71d89
address
bc1plpnkxah75949j9487z5n9n803h0hjantz2t8567uyuawghdhrkys2xj97q
transaction
89aeebf961b73d75620cad6a9cdaf6d2cd539cd59a40a99967138e116d14ab52
spent
true